I have been a casual backyard cook over the years using a gas grill and a Weber kettle charcoal grill. About 10 years ago I started frying a turkey at Thanksgiving. A week ago, I bought the Char Broil Big Easy because I was tired of the mess and expense of the oil turkey fryer and have spent a lot of time this week reading the forums. I was referred to this site by TMB. After realizing that TBE can be used for more than just cooking chicken or turkey, I am sure it will be used much more than just once a year, which is what happened with the fryer.
